What Switzerland is like in February

Best snow of the season at altitude; Swiss & EU school holidays push prices up. Jun–Sep for hiking, lakes, and trains through wildflowers. Dec–Mar for skiing. Apr–May and Oct–Nov are quiet shoulder months.

Insider tip

Mountain hotels often close in May & November between seasons.

What to pack for Switzerland in February

12 essentials grouped by category — tap to expand.

Clothing

  • Insulated waterproof ski jacket & salopettes
  • Thermal base layers (merino top + bottom)
  • Mid-layer fleece or down sweater
  • Ski socks (2+ pairs) and après-ski boots
  • Beanie, neck gaiter, ski gloves + glove liners

Health

  • SPF 50 lip balm and face cream (altitude burns hard)

Gear

  • Ski goggles with low-light lens
  • Helmet (rent at resort to save luggage)
  • Compact daypack for cable-car days

Documents

  • Swiss Travel Pass or Half Fare Card
  • Travel insurance with off-piste cover

Tech

  • Type J adapter (Switzerland-specific 3-pin)
